Sketch组件:高效创建和管理设计元素的完整指南222


Sketch作为一款强大的UI设计软件,其组件功能是提升设计效率和保持设计一致性的关键。 巧妙地使用组件,可以让你从重复性劳动中解放出来,专注于更具创造性的设计工作。 本文将全面讲解如何在Sketch中创建、使用和管理组件,帮助你掌握这一核心技能,提升你的设计流程。

一、创建组件:从零开始

创建组件是整个流程的起点。 一个好的组件应该具备模块化、可重用和可维护的特性。 在Sketch中创建组件非常简单:首先,你需要选中你想要作为组件的图层或图层组。 然后,点击右键菜单,选择“Create Symbol”(创建符号)。 Sketch会自动将你的选区转换为一个组件,并将其添加到你的“Symbols”面板(如果面板未显示,你可以通过菜单栏的“View > Show Symbols”来打开它)。

命名规范至关重要: 组件的命名应该清晰、简洁且具有描述性,以便于你在项目中快速查找和识别。 建议使用帕斯卡命名法(例如:ButtonPrimary,IconButton),或者采用你的团队内部一致的命名规范。 良好的命名习惯能有效避免混淆,并提升团队协作效率。

实例与主组件: 当你将一个组件放置到画布上时,你实际上是在使用它的“实例”。 修改主组件的属性(例如颜色、文本、大小等),所有该组件的实例都会同步更新。 这正是组件的强大之处,它确保了整个项目中设计元素的一致性。 修改实例的属性,只会影响该单个实例,而不会改变主组件。

二、组件的嵌套使用:提高复杂度的处理能力

Sketch允许你将组件嵌套在其他组件中,从而创建更复杂的组件。 例如,你可以创建一个包含按钮和文本标签的“卡片组件”,然后将这个“卡片组件”用在列表视图中。 这可以极大地简化复杂界面的设计和维护,减少冗余代码和错误。

嵌套组件时,需要注意层次结构的清晰性。 良好的层次结构可以让你更轻松地理解和管理组件,并方便进行修改和调试。 建议在创建嵌套组件时,遵循一定的命名规范,并使用分组功能来组织图层。

三、组件的更新与管理:保持设计的一致性

组件的优势在于其可更新性。 当你需要修改组件的设计时,只需要修改主组件,所有实例都会自动更新。 这可以确保你的设计保持一致性,并减少因修改而产生的错误。

在“Symbols”面板中,你可以看到所有创建的组件,并对其进行管理。 你可以重命名组件、删除组件、以及重新组织组件的层次结构。 Sketch也提供搜索功能,方便你快速查找所需的组件。

四、利用组件的属性面板:精细化控制

每个组件都拥有一个属性面板,允许你对组件的属性进行精细化的控制。 你可以设置组件的文本、颜色、大小、形状等属性,以及一些更高级的属性,例如过渡动画和交互效果。 充分利用组件的属性面板,可以让你更好地控制组件的外观和行为。

五、组件的优化技巧:提升设计效率

为了最大限度地发挥组件的优势,以下是一些优化技巧:
保持组件的简洁性: 避免创建过于复杂的组件,这会降低组件的可重用性和可维护性。
合理使用约束: 利用Sketch的约束功能,可以使组件在不同尺寸的屏幕上保持良好的比例和布局。
定期清理组件库: 定期删除不再使用的组件,可以保持组件库的整洁和效率。
利用Sketch插件: 一些Sketch插件可以帮助你更有效地管理和使用组件。

六、组件在团队协作中的作用

在团队协作中,组件的作用尤为重要。 它可以确保整个团队使用统一的设计元素,提高设计的一致性和效率。 团队成员可以使用相同的组件库,避免了重复创建相同元素的情况,并减少了沟通成本。 有效的组件管理也方便了团队成员之间的协作和代码复用。

七、总结

熟练掌握Sketch组件的使用,是成为高效Sketch用户的关键。 通过合理的创建、命名、嵌套和管理组件,你可以显著提高设计效率,保持设计一致性,并简化团队协作流程。 希望本文能帮助你更好地理解和应用Sketch组件,提升你的设计能力。

2025-04-24


上一篇:Sketch中图形超出画板的解决方法及技巧

下一篇:Sketch软件绘制逼真折叠门效果教程